IP Address Leasing: A Comprehensive Guide
IP address assignment via click here temporary assignment is a essential aspect of modern network infrastructure . This process ensures that available IP addresses are given to devices connecting a network, rather than being permanently tied to a single machine . Typically, a DHCP (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ol) server manages this function , automatically supplying IP addresses and other network settings for a defined duration , after which the address returns available for another assignment. This approach allows for optimal resource allocation and prevents IP address errors within the network .

Dynamic vs. Static IP: Should You Lease?
Deciding between a dynamic received IP address and a static unchanging one can feel like a confusing puzzle. Most , your internet service provider network provides you with a dynamic IP, which periodically regularly changes. This usually signifies a cost-effective budget-friendly option and is perfectly acceptable for everyday browsing, streaming, and emailing. However, if you're running a server, using remote desktop software, or require consistent access to your equipment from remotely , a static IP address might be necessary . Weigh the simplicity of a dynamic IP against the stability of a static IP – and ultimately whether paying for one is a worthwhile expense for your particular situation.
